Hallo, ich habe vor kurzen ein System aufgebaut, welches im Moment auf 2 SQL Abfragen basiert. Ich möchte diese nun zu einer zusammenfassen, wenn dies möglich ist. Dazu bräuchte ich Eure Hilfe Ich hab zwei Tabellen: portal_items -itemID -description -active (beschreibt per 0 und 1 ob der Artikel angezeigt werden soll) -... user_items -userID Alle Daten aus 'portal_items' werden dem User aufgelistet. Unter jedem Eintrag soll es nun zwei Alternativen geben. 1) Wenn der User dieses Item noch nicht in einen "Korb" hat, soll er ein Button sehen, mit dessen er dieses Item in sein Korb legen kann. (user_item wird gefüllt) 2) Wenn der User bereits einen Eintrag in user_items hat, soll dort anstelle eines Buttons der Text "Item bereits vorhanden" stehen. Wie gesagt, läuft das System momentan auf zwei Abfragen. Sql select mehrere werte zusammenfassen e. Meine erste Ansätze um einen Query zu erstellen sehen folgender Maßen aus: Source Code SELECT portal. *, user. * FROM portal_items portal LEFT JOIN user_items user ON( =) WHERE = 1 AND = $aktuelleUserID Das Problem bei dieser Abfrage ist, das er nur die Daten auflistet, wo bereits ein Eintrag in user_items besteht.
#1 Hey und zwar steh ich bei einer Aufgabe grade echt auf dem Schlauch: und zwar soll ich alle Ansprechpartner anzeigen lassen, die genau 3 Telefonnummern haben (soweit kein Problem). Jedoch sollen alle 3 Telefonnummern in einer Zeile (siehe Bild) ausgegeben werden. Wie kann ich mir jetzt noch die 2 Telefonnummer anzeigen lassen? So sieht der Code bis jetzt aus: Code: SELECT _id, _name, _vorname, MIN(t2. ak_kommunikation) AS Telefon1, '' AS Telefon2, MAX(t2. ak_kommunikation) AS Telefon3, COUNT(*) AS Anzahl FROM aa_ansprechpartner AS t1 INNER JOIN aa_kommunikation AS t2 ON _id = t2. ak_asp_id AND t2. Sql wie kann ich mehrere Datensätze zu einem zusammenfassen? (Computer, Programmieren, Datenbank). ak_kom_art = 'Telefon' GROUP BY _id, _name, _vorname HAVING (COUNT(t2. ak_kommunikation)=3) Bin für jeden Lösungsvorschlag sehr dankbar Mit freundlichen Grüßen Armas #2 Eine Möglichkeit wäre WITH t3 AS ( SELECT _id, _name, _vorname FROM aa_ansprechpartner t1 INNER JOIN aa_kommunikation t2 GROUP BY _id, HAVING count(t2. ak_kommunikation) = 3), t5 AS ( SELECT ROW_NUMBER() OVER (PARTITION BY t4.
SQL - Werte einer Spalte aneinanderhängen | - Die BSD-Community Startseite Foren Allgemeine Computerthemen Programmieren Du verwendest einen veralteten Browser. Es ist möglich, dass diese oder andere Websites nicht korrekt angezeigt werden. Du solltest ein Upgrade durchführen oder einen alternativen Browser verwenden. #1 Hallo Leute, ich habe einen String, aufgrund der vorgegebenen Feldgröße auf mehrere Zeilen verteilt. Ist es möglich diesen String mit nur einem Select vollständig zurück zu erhalten? Ich finde es etwas lästig dies im Programm selbst zu erledigen. Es muss nicht unbedingt ANSI-SQL sein, MSSQL-Syntax würde mir in diesem Fall reichen. SQL Abfrage: alle Ergebniszeilen in einer Zeile zusammenfassen - Supportnet Forum. Ich weis das man Felder beim selektieren mit '+' aneinander hängen kann aber mein eigentliches Problem ist das ich zu diesem Zeitpunkt nicht weis wieviele Zeilen ich habe, sonst könnte ich ja eine entsprechende Anzahl von subselects verwenden. (Aber eigentlich interessiert mich diese Anzahl nicht sondern nur der String) Gibt es vielleicht noch einen anderen Lösungsansatz?
SELECT CONVERT(VARCHAR(5), @mybin1) + ' ' + CONVERT(VARCHAR(5), @mybin2) -- Here is the same conversion using CAST. SELECT CAST(@mybin1 AS VARCHAR(5)) + ' ' + CAST(@mybin2 AS VARCHAR(5)) Ergebnistypen Gibt einen Wert vom Datentyp des Arguments zurück, das in der Rangfolge am höchsten steht. Weitere Informationen finden Sie unter Datentyprangfolge (Transact-SQL). Hinweise Der +-Operator (Verketten von Zeichenfolgen) verhält sich anders, wenn er zusammen mit einer leeren Zeichenfolge verwendet wird, als wenn er mit einem NULL-Wert oder unbekannten Werten verwendet wird. 2. SELECT – Daten auswählen – -Trainer.de. Eine leere Zeichenfolge lässt sich als zwei einfache Anführungszeichen ohne Zeichen innerhalb der Anführungszeichen angeben. Eine leere binäre Zeichenfolge lässt sich als 0x ohne Bytewerte in der hexadezimalen Konstante angeben. Beim Verketten einer leeren Zeichenfolge werden immer die beiden angegebenen Zeichenfolgen verkettet. Wenn Sie mit Zeichenfolgen mit einem NULL-Wert arbeiten, hängt das Ergebnis der Verkettung von den Sitzungseinstellungen ab.
+ (Verketten von Zeichenfolgen) (Transact-SQL) - SQL Server | Microsoft Docs Weiter zum Hauptinhalt Dieser Browser wird nicht mehr unterstützt. Führen Sie ein Upgrade auf Microsoft Edge durch, um die neuesten Features, Sicherheitsupdates und den technischen Support zu nutzen. Artikel 04/18/2022 4 Minuten Lesedauer Ist diese Seite hilfreich? Haben Sie weiteres Feedback für uns? Feedback wird an Microsoft gesendet: Wenn Sie auf die Sendeschaltfläche klicken, wird Ihr Feedback verwendet, um Microsoft-Produkte und -Dienste zu verbessern. Datenschutzrichtlinie Vielen Dank. In diesem Artikel Gilt für: SQL Server (alle unterstützten Versionen) Azure SQL-Datenbank Azure SQL verwaltete Instanz Azure Synapse Analytics Analytics Platform System (PDW) Ein Operator in einem Zeichenfolgenausdruck, der zwei oder mehr Zeichenfolgen, binäre Zeichenfolgen oder Spalten oder eine Kombination aus Zeichenfolgen und Spaltennamen zu einem Ausdruck verkettet (ein Zeichenfolgenoperator). Sql select mehrere werte zusammenfassen data. SELECT 'book'+'case'; gibt beispielsweise bookcase zurück.
ANMELDUNG: Bis 6 Wochen vor Beginn der Motorradtour, danach auf Anfrage.
Urlaub so individuell wie Du: Bring Dein eigenes Motorrad mit oder lass uns wissen, mit welcher Maschine Du Dein Abenteuer bei uns erleben möchtest – wir kümmern uns darum. In der Biker-Garage steht vom Schraubenschlüssel bis zum Luftdruckgerät alles zu Deiner Verfügung. Geführte Motorradreisen. Wähle für dich eines unserer diversen geführten Tourenprogramme aus, oder erkunde die Gegend auf eigene Faust… Die Bausteine für deinen perfekten Motorradurlaub bestimmst Du selbst. Wir stehen Dir bei Deinen Wünschen und Fragen von Biker zu Biker in jedem Fall mit Rat und Tat zur Seite, und sorgen dafür, dass Dein Traum vom perfekten Bikerurlaub in Erfüllung geht!
Allgemeine Informationen zur Motorradtour Die Adventure Country Tracks (ACT) von Touratech kombinieren die interessantesten Motorradstrecken mit atemberaubenden Landschaften und purem Fahrspaß, sind perfekt ausgearbeitet und lassen sich innerhalb eines ganz normalen Urlaubs bewältigen – 100 Prozent konzentriertes Abenteuer! Sorgfältig ausgearbeitete Routen führen durch die schönsten Regionen Europas. Kleiner Wermutstropfen: Die ACT Portugal kann man aus Versicherungsgründen nicht mit lokalen Miet-Motorrädern fahren, sagt Touratech. Man muss also sein eigenes Bike mitbringen. Gleiches gilt für 4x4-Fahrzeuge. DIE 10 BESTEN Portugal Touren mit Allradfahrzeug - 2022 - Viator. Tourbeschreibung Einmal von Nord nach Süd, 1. 250 km durch das Portweinland und das abseits der Straßen – mit unseren Ducati Desert Sleds ein pures Abenteuer. Atemberaubenden Landschaften und purer Fahrspaß stehen auf dieser Tour an oberster Stelle. Bücher, Landkarten & Reiseführer Anreise Der Weg ist das Ziel – das gilt auch für die Fahrt nach Portugal auf eigener Achse. Von Deutschland aus geht es am schnellsten via Frankreich (Metz – Châlons-en-Champagne – Troyes – Tours – Bordeaux – Biarritz) und Spanien (San Sebastian – Valladolid) nach Braganca (1.
449, 00 € ADVENTURE COUNTRY TRACKS - ITALIEN 24. 09. 2022 ACT Italien ist eine Tour voller Überraschungen und Abwechslung in 5 Tage September 1. 549, 00 € ADVENTURE COUNTRY TRACKS - PYRENÄEN 18. 499, 00 € Sardinien - immer eine Reise wert 17. 2022 Warum gerade Sardinien? Diese ungewöhnliche Insel hat mit Ihren einsamen 7 Tage September